Transaction ed71dab04ea0e9e3eb9922a689a1511374799b89ef96f7e30f5cb12d3fd7aa73
1 Input
1 Output
-
ed71dab04ea0e9e3eb9922a689a1511374799b89ef96f7e30f5cb12d3fd7aa73:0
- value
- 314262
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4463a8670c36ae456ebacb5eb85817defc0ab01 OP_EQUAL
- address
- 3KapViFwX44guekS5FModfuUY2tuggcPaA